"Post Postapocalyptic Entities" is a compelling conceptual installation that investigates the survival and transmutation of form in a world beyond collapse. Rather than depicting the immediate chaos of annihilation, the artwork fast-forwards to a silent, secondary genesis—a speculative future where techno-industrial debris and biological resilience merge to give birth to a new ecosystem.
Crafted from scavenged metal sheets, intricately wound wires, and corroded structures, these hollow yet expressive creatures emerge as the new inhabitants of a scarred topography. The dynamic dialogue between the elevated entity within its makeshift metallic shelter and the terrestrial figure below suggests a nascent social order, an adaptive intelligence forged from remnants.
Through a conceptual framework, the installation shifts the narrative from doom to unexpected endurance. It challenges the viewer to reconsider the boundaries between the artificial and the organic, transforming the industrial detritus of human hubris into the raw scaffolding of a reinvented evolutionary cycle."
